Advantages of CNC Machining Services
Compared with traditional manual machining and traditional CNC machining, CNC machining has many advantages, including:

1. High precision: CNC machining can achieve high-precision machining and meet the precision requirements of microns and above. This is very important for the manufacture of some parts with high dimensional accuracy requirements.
2. High efficiency: CNC machining can achieve automated production, reduce the time and errors of human operation, and improve production efficiency. Machines can run continuously for 24 hours, which greatly improves production efficiency.
3. Flexibility: CNC machining can be quickly adjusted and set according to different machining requirements, so they can adapt to diverse product machining needs. This it particularly suitable for small batch production and customization.
4. Complex part machining capability: CNC can realize the machining of complex parts, such as complex surfaces and multi-process machining, which increases the diversity and flexibility of production.

5. Improve production quality: CNC machining reduces errors caused by manually factors, and improves the consistency and quality stability of product processing.
6. Cost reduction: Although the investment in CNC machine tools is relatively high, its advantages such as high efficiency and high precision can reduce labor costs and scrap rates, and in the long term, reduce processing costs.
In general, the advantages of CNC machining are high precision, high efficiency, flexibility, adaptability to complex part processing, improved production quality and cost reduction, which has made it an indispensable and important technological means in modern manufacturing.
